     Are you ready to be set free from 'issues' that have been holding you back, or, hindering your freedom and growth in Christ?  Issues like these: fear of failure, fear of success, denial (everyone else has the problem, not me), being aloof and cold (I don't need anyone else), insecurity, jealousy, defensiveness, self-pity, isolation, chip on the shoulder; martyr mentality (why is it always me that have to give), depression, controlling and manipulative, victim mentality, loneliness, fear of intimacy, argumentative, pessimistic, anxieties, just to name a few of the issues that we can be guilty of allowing to dominate or control our lives.  We must be like the woman with the 'issue' of blood.  "And a woman having an issue of blood twelve years, which had spent all her living upon physicians, neither could be healed of any, Came behind him, and touched the border of his garment: and immediately her issue of blood stanched.  And Jesus said, Who touched me?  When all denied, Peter and they that were with him said, Master, the multitude throng thee and press thee, and sayest thou, Who touched me?   And Jesus said, Somebody hath touched me: for I perceive that virtue is gone out of me.  And when the woman saw that she was not hid, she came trembling, and falling down before him, she declared unto him before all the people for what cause she had touched him, and how she was healed immediately."  (Luke 8:43-47) Issue means a flow, to run like water; to rush or draw; the action of going out or flowing out; the action of coming forth from, or as if from something in which one is immersed.  Isn't that indicative of the list of issues that was mentioned, they flow out, as well as immersing the person in them.  What are the issues that have been flowing from our heart?  What do you need to be healed and delivered of?  Listen, this is how we can begin to see ourselves free from 'issues' of the heart as well as any other issue.  "Keep thy heart with all diligence; for out of it are the issues of life." (Prov. 4:23)  This verse reads like this in the Amplified Bible; "Keep and guard your heart with all vigilance and above all that you guard, for out of it flow the springs of life." You may not have a bloody issue that has kept others from drawing close to you as this woman had, but what issues has kept others from drawing close to you, or kept you from drawing closer to even God?  These issues of the heart are more diseased than even the issue of blood, because a lot of the time they go without being healed.  The issue of blood must have tainted every area of her life.  It kept her isolated and separated from intimate contact.  It had caused her to become hard, tough, and 'self-absorbed'.  Yet, it also produced in her a fight to live and someday be healed.  She recognized her need to be set free from what she was immersed in and what was coming out of her.  Do you recognize your need to touch the hem of His garment and be made whole?  Has that 'issue' caused you to be friendless, or have strained relationship?  Has it separated you from your 'would-be' champions and cheerleaders in your life, by making you draw inward?  Has it made you hard, callous, sharp, insensitive, or overbearing?  Has it made you timid, weak, and afraid of challenges in your life?  Are you tired of being tired?  Will you dare to come closer to Him?

     If you are, then one of the first thing we must do is; "My son, attend to my words; consent and submit to my sayings.  Let them not depart from your sight; keep them in the center of your heart.  For they are life to those who find them, healing and health to all their flesh." (Prov.4:20-22) Of course, this is the answer to keeping your heart clean, that you are immersed in is His Word, so that all that flows from you now will be pure issues, not diseased ones.  His Word will heal you of everything in the list of 'issues' and all that are not listed.  The Word will put new life in, as the Word flushes the 'old issues' out.  We must be diligent about keeping the Word in the center of our hearts, by reading, meditating, listening, and doing it.  The Word can heal us of all issues of life, only we must allow it to, by being diligent.  The woman with the issue of blood was diligent.  She had to have been a student of the Word to know that Jesus would have healing in the hem of His garment.  "But unto you who revere and worshipfully fear My name shall the Sun of Righteousness arise with healing in His wings and His beams…" (Malachi 4:2)  She knew that wings meant extremity, edge, border, corner, skirt, shirt, the corner (of garment).  She kept the Word in the center of her heart and she was made whole.  The Word that she meditated on moved her into action.  She was willing to be vunerable and even exposed in order to be healed.  She had to do something with the faith that was arising in her heart.  She pressed into a crowd, that could have stoned her for her action of faith.  She was made whole—–safe,delivered, protected, preserved, healed, made to do well and be sound, with nothing left out.  So can you be made whole as well, choose to keep the Word diligently before your eyes and issues must depart!
